Because of the rear blow dry the wind shield wiper broke. I was said the same that there are no precautions to be taken but the dealer said that it was a common problem which is kinda not convincing. What will happen if something like this happen if your car is out of warranty?
#4
Senior Member
I've had some car washes tape the rear wiper to the window so that it doesn't flap around when the air blast from the dryer hits it.
